A career in Health and Social Care is more than just a job. It’s an opportunity to make a real difference to some of the most vulnerable people and communities in society.
The rewards for such a selfless career are incredible. There’s no better feeling than putting a smile on someone else’s face or receiving a ‘thank you’ for helping out with simple tasks.
Those who already work in the sector will tell you that it is no 9-5 job where you can leave, and all the thoughts from your working day fade away. You’ll find yourself thinking about those you care for throughout the day, wondering how they’re getting on or thinking of new ways to improve their life.

Our BSc (Hons) Health and Social Care offers you the opportunity to develop the values, skills and knowledge essential to good health and social care practice, opening the door to a huge range of rewarding employment opportunities. Balancing policy, practice, and academic training, our course is strongly linked to the UK government’s agendas for Health and Social Care.
Any subjects are acceptable at Level 3. You should also have five GCSEs at grade C or above or grade 4 to 9 (or equivalent). If you have extensive appropriate work experience within the health and social care sector, but don’t meet the entry requirements for this course, please consider our FdA Health & Social Care.
